Transaction efccb09b4177278926a38664d66ddb68ac37a68eb51d3fad0355726322ea2337

1 Input
2 Outputs
  • efccb09b4177278926a38664d66ddb68ac37a68eb51d3fad0355726322ea2337:0
  • value  13217375
    address  14v2zEnRNq27XeqMjKhFJ6nEAMgmtoiwMr
  • efccb09b4177278926a38664d66ddb68ac37a68eb51d3fad0355726322ea2337:1
  • value  84657935
    address  1DfthPqx5kp7u4bKn3rnTHd5Po8o98zRJX